The chemical composition of Stainless Steel 304/304L includes an optimum balance of chromium (18–20%) and nickel (8–12%), providing strong resistance against atmospheric corrosion, moisture, industrial chemicals, and mildly aggressive environments. The lower carbon variant, 304L, is particularly beneficial for welded structural applications, minimizing the chances of intergranular corrosion. Chemical Composition (Typical wt%)
| Element | 304 | 304L |
|---|---|---|
| Carbon (C) | 0.08% max | 0.03% max |
| Chromium (Cr) | 18.0 – 20.0% | 18.0 – 20.0% |
| Nickel (Ni) | 8.0 – 12.0% | 8.0 – 12.0% |
| Manganese (Mn) | ≤ 2.0% | ≤ 2.0% |
| Silicon (Si) | ≤ 1.0% | ≤ 1.0% |
| Phosphorus (P) | ≤ 0.045% | ≤ 0.045% |
| Sulfur (S) | ≤ 0.03% | ≤ 0.03% |
Mechanical Properties (Typical)
| Property | Approximate Value |
|---|---|
| Tensile Strength (Rm) | ≈ 500 – 520 MPa |
| Yield Strength (Re) | ≈ 200 – 205 MPa |
| Elongation | ≥ 40% (may vary with profile size and finish) |
| Hardness | Typical: ≤ 95 HRB |
Equivalent Grades / Cross References
| Standard / Spec System | Equivalent Grade |
|---|---|
| AISI / UNS | 304 → S30400, 304L → S30403 |
| EN / WNR / DIN | 304 → 1.4301, 304L → 1.4307 |
| JIS | 304 → SUS 304, 304L → SUS 304L |

Q1: What is the difference between SS 304 and 304L for angles and channels?
A: The main difference is carbon content — 304L has lower carbon (≤ 0.03%) which reduces carbide precipitation after welding, making it more suitable for welded structural assemblies. Both grades offer excellent corrosion resistance and mechanical strength, but 304L gives better performance in welded or fabricated structures.
